1

/ビデオ/ドキュメントのマージ

PDF をビデオに変換するテンプレートが必要です。残念ながら、/video/merge ロボットには、フレームレート (スライドの長さ) とビデオの長さの両方が必要なようです。PDF のページ数がわからないため、期間を指定できません。

これを回避する方法はありますか?

これは私の現在のテンプレートのセクションです:

"pdf_to_images": {
  "use": ":original",
  "robot": "/document/thumbs",
  "format": "png",
  "width": 1920,
  "height": 1080
},
"encode": {
  "use": {
    "steps": [
      {
        "name": "pdf_to_images",
        "as": "image"
      }
    ]
  },
  "robot": "/video/merge",
  "preset": "iphone",
  "width": 1920,
  "height": 1080,
  "ffmpeg": {
    "b": "8000K"
  },
  "framerate": "${fields.framerate}",
  "duration": "100"
},
//...store...

アップロードのフィールドから「フレームレート」を置き換える必要がありますが、「pdf_to_images」からの結果の数を動的にカウントする「期間」を置き換えることはできますか?

そうしないと、「pdf_to_images」の各画像結果から個々のビデオを作成し、それらを連結することに行き詰まっています。これは、リソースの資本化の点でかなり過剰に思えます。

考え?

4

1 に答える 1